#b358ec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b358ec is composed of 70.2% red, 34.5% green and 92.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 24.2% cyan, 62.7% magenta, 0% yellow and 7.5% black. It has a hue angle of 276.9 degrees, a saturation of 79.6% and a lightness of 63.5%. #b358ec color hex could be obtained by blending #ffb0ff with #6700d9. Closest websafe color is: #cc66ff.

Shades and Tints of #b358ec
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060109 is the darkest color, while #fbf7f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#b358ec
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a3a0a4 is the less saturated color, while #b64afa is the most saturated one.
